About this listen
This book focuses on the life of Jacob Hofheins. His life is one that inspires greatness of purpose within the Hofheins line. Jacob was a brick mason, helped build the Nauvoo Temple, was a bodyguard to the Prophet Joseph Smith, witnessed the Martyrdom of the Prophet Joseph, witnessed the mobbing’s and persecutions against the saints, was recruited to join the US army to fight against Mexico in the Mormon Battalion, built the first adobe house in Salt Lake City, Helped build the foundation of the Salt Lake Temple, was called to lead the settlement of the Little Salt Lake Valley (Parowan), served a German and English speaking Mission to New York State, Lead a company of over 200 saints across the plains to the Salt Lake Valley, and had 3 wives and 17 Children (5 of which died shortly after birth) according to Familysearch.org. He truly believed after joining The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ints that it is most important to serve the Lord. This Book contains transcriptions of information and Histories of Jacob Hofheins that could be found. This book is sold at the lowest price point available. Our only desire is to provide a way for the line of the Hofheins family to discover the inspiring life of Jacob Hofheins and discover why his testimony of Jesus Christ and His Restored Gospel led him to make the decisions he made.
